Maria Ghițulica

Maria Ghițulică (born August 26, 1938 in Gogoșu , Dolj district ) is a former Romanian politician of the Romanian Communist Party PMR (Partidul Muncitoresc Român) and from 1965 PCR (Partidul Comunist Român) , who was a candidate for the Political Executive Committee between 1984 and 1989 of the Central Committee (ZK) of the PCR.

Life

Maria Ghițulică began studying journalism after attending school and, after joining the Partidul Muncitoresc Român (PMR) in 1958, between 1959 and 1961 also studied at the party college " Ștefan Gheorghiu " . She also worked for a transport company in Timișoara and in 1961 became an editor in the literary section of the youth newspaper Scânteia tineretului .

She also obtained a PhD from the Faculty of Philosophy at the Academy of Social and Political Sciences "Ștefan Gheorghiu" . Later she was an instructor in the Central Committee department for cadres and in 1969 an advisor in the party committee in the Bucharest district, Section 2 , to which the Colentina, Iancului, Pantelimon and Tei districts belong, and there she was an instructor for public relations and legal issues. In 1974 she was again an instructor in the Central Committee department for cadres and in August 1979 secretary for propaganda of the party committee in the Olt district .

Maria Ghițulică became a member of the Central Committee of the PCR at the Twelfth Party Congress of the PCR from November 19 to 23, 1979 and was a member of this until the Romanian Revolution on December 22, 1989 . On May 24, 1982, she became First Secretary of the Party Committee in Vrancea County and President of the Executive Committee of the People's Council in Vrancea County.

At the thirteenth party congress of the PCR from November 19 to 22, 1984 , she also became a candidate for the Political Executive Committee of the Central Committee and remained in this position until December 22, 1989. Maria Ghițulică also became Vice-President of the State Council on April 1, 1985 ( Consiliului de Stat) , the collective body that provided the President. Most recently she was between April 15, 1987 and 1989 First Secretary of the Party Committee in Iași County and President of the Executive Committee of the People's Council in Iași County.

In 1980 she became a member of the Grand National Assembly (Marea Adunare Națională) for the first time and represented in this until 1985 first the constituency of Studina No. 6 and between 1985 and 1989 the constituency of Vrancea . During her parliamentary membership, she was secretary of the Grand National Assembly from April 1, 1980 to 1985.
